Abstract
An apparatus and a system, as well as a method and article, may operate to circulate a coolant through a thermal conduit thermally coupled to a chassis heat exchange element including a plurality of receiving sections thermally coupled to a corresponding plurality of electronic devices. The temperature of one or more of the plurality of electronic devices may be sensed, and the flow rate of the coolant adjusted in accordance with the sensed temperature. The thermal conduit may include thermally conductive, flow disrupting elements. The chassis heat exchange element may operate in a downhole environment, including logging and drilling operations.
